This essential guide to marketing libraries' e-resources shows librarians how to make sure their customers understand what is available to them online and allow them to use their e-resources fully. Marketing Your Library's Electronic Resources provides practical guidance on creating marketing programmes to allow librarians to get the word out about their e-resources. The book explains how libraries cannot just rely on discovery systems to make their customer aware of their e-resources and that the value of marketing means that the library knows its patrons well enough to say, "Out of all of these available resources, it's this one, this is the one you want." Readers will be shown how to develop, implement, and assess marketing plans, understand marketing terminology and save time, effort and money while increasing the use of vital library resources and making customers happier and more successful.
